About this tag
The cryptographic tag on WindowsForum.com covers discussions about cryptographic protocols, services, and certificate validation in Windows environments. Topics include using TLS for secure communication in Windows IoT Core apps, troubleshooting Cryptographic Services errors that prevent software installation due to untrusted cabinet files, and resolving Windows Update errors linked to cryptographic failures. Recurring themes involve enabling and verifying cryptographic services, validating digital certificates, and ensuring data encryption and integrity. These threads provide practical guidance for developers and IT professionals dealing with cryptographic issues on Windows systems.
